ChrisSlicks 04-09-2009 02:33 PM

Quote:

Originally Posted by zeebra (Post 54213)
Danny they posted their Dyno graph up.. If you look at blog.stillen Stillen's cat back makes like 4whp less then theres. /laugh

Negative. You can not compare the numbers directly as these were different dyno's, you can only compare the gains over the base run. With the stock cats this exhaust gains 10 whp.
